Driving Directions
Since many streets are closed for move-in, we provide residence-hall specific driving directions to get you to the unloading zone for check-in. Please use these and not GPS to drive into campus for move-in.
St. Philip Street from Vanderhorst to Calhoun Streets will be restricted to unloading for McAlister and Berry Halls and CLOSED to THRU TRAFFIC. There is a road closure at St. Philip Street and Vanderhorst Streets where you will stop until directed to proceed as curb space opens on St. Philip Street by Berry Hall.
Please note that there will be NO ACCESS to St. Philip Street from Calhoun Street.
From I-26: Take exit 221B and turn RIGHT onto Meeting Street. Turn RIGHT onto Columbus Street, then LEFT onto King Street. Turn RIGHT onto Vanderhorst Street just before Saint Matthew's Lutheran Church, then turn LEFT on St. Philip Street.
From Highway 17 North: After you cross the Ashley River, bear LEFT at the first fork, following signs for Cannon Street. At the next fork, stay RIGHT and continue down Cannon Street. Turn RIGHT onto Rutledge Avenue, turn LEFT onto Vanderhorst Street, then turn RIGHT onto St. Philip Street.
From Highway 17 South: After you cross the Cooper River, follow signs for Hwy 17 S, then bear RIGHT onto the King Street exit ramp. Turn RIGHT on King Street, turn RIGHT onto Vanderhorst Street just before Saint Matthew's Lutheran Church, then turn LEFT on St. Philip Street.

Unloading: Curbside on St. Philip Street
There is a road closure at St. Philip and Vanderhorst Streets; you will be directed to proceed as curb space opens on St. Philip Street by McAlister Hall.
Unattended vehicles in the unloading area are subject to towing.
Your helpers can start unloading while you get your key and parking map.
We have more than 1,000 students (and their helpers) moving in each day. Unloading areas are limited and we all need to work together for a safe and efficient move-in. Please be aware of the following:
- Limit the amount of time you’re stopped in a designated unloading-only zone.
- Unattended vehicles are subject to towing.
- You cannot park in an unloading zone nor leave it unattended even for a few minutes. Please also do not park or leave your vehicle unattended at a bagged parking meter.
- Unload your vehicle and then move it to a designated move-in parking area.

Key Pickup Location: McAlister Hall
You will pick up your key at McAlister Hall (80B St. Philip Street) on the St. Philip Street side, across from PG Garage.
Only students can pick up their key. You will need to provide a government-issued ID (e.g., a driver’s license) to get your key, and to get your Cougar Card if you did not get one during orientation. Make sure you get your parking map/dashboard flier when you get your key.

Parking: PG Garage (max 3 hours)
Students will be given a parking map when they get their key. The flip side must be on your dash, and include the vehicle-driver's phone number, when you are on campus.
Follow the parking instructions for your hall below. Note that each student will be given a 3-hour garage voucher when they get their key. Although vouchers are valid in multiple garages (Aquarium Garage, George Garage, St. Philip St. Garage or the Visitor’s Center Garage), pay attention to which surface lot or garage your hall indicates.
After unloading, you will be directed to park in the PG garage where you can park for a maximum of three hours. You must find parking off campus after three hours.
- If there is not parking available in PG, you may park in the Aquarium Garage and ride the CARTA DASH bus back to campus for free. Each student will be given a 3-hour garage voucher when they get their key. If you park in the Aquarium Garage, you do not have to move your car after three hours; however, you will need to pay for any time parked beyond then.
- Do not leave your vehicle in the unloading zone – you will be subject to towing.
